Haifa Student Beach Stabbing Seriously Wounds Two Men

Two men from Basmat Tab'un were seriously wounded Saturday evening in a stabbing near Haifa's Student Beach, also known as Dado South Beach. Reports citing MDA said the call came at 19:46 in the Carmel area and that medics evacuated two men, about 30 and 35, to Rambam Health Care Campus with severe penetrating wounds. Police and forensic teams arrived at the beach, collected evidence and treated the initial background as likely criminal.
